122 +
123 +
124 +static int parse_cfe_partitions( struct mtd_info *master, struct mtd_partition **pparts)
125 +{
126 +       int nrparts = 3, curpart = 0; /* CFE,NVRAM and global LINUX are always present. */
127 +       struct bcm_tag *buf;
128 +       struct mtd_partition *parts;
129 +       int ret;
130 +       size_t retlen;
131 +       unsigned int rootfsaddr, kerneladdr, spareaddr;
132 +       unsigned int rootfslen, kernellen, sparelen, totallen;
133 +       int namelen = 0;
134 +       int i;
135 +       char *boardid;
136 +        char *tagversion;
137 +
138 +       /* Allocate memory for buffer */
139 +       buf = vmalloc(sizeof(struct bcm_tag));
140 +       if (!buf)
141 +               return -ENOMEM;
142 +
143 +       /* Get the tag */
144 +       ret = master->read(master, master->erasesize, sizeof(struct bcm_tag), &retlen, (void *)buf);
145 +       if (retlen != sizeof(struct bcm_tag)){
146 +               vfree(buf);
147 +               return -EIO;
148 +       }
149 +
150 +       sscanf(buf->kernelAddress, "%u", &kerneladdr);
151 +       sscanf(buf->kernelLength, "%u", &kernellen);
152 +       sscanf(buf->totalLength, "%u", &totallen);
153 +       tagversion = &(buf->tagVersion[0]);
154 +       boardid = &(buf->boardid[0]);
155 +
156 +       printk(KERN_INFO PFX "CFE boot tag found with version %s and board type %s\n",tagversion, boardid);
157 +
158 +       kerneladdr = kerneladdr - EXTENDED_SIZE;
159 +       rootfsaddr = kerneladdr + kernellen;
160 +       spareaddr = roundup(totallen, master->erasesize) + master->erasesize;
161 +       sparelen = master->size - spareaddr - master->erasesize;
162 +       rootfslen = spareaddr - rootfsaddr;
163 +
164 +       /* Determine number of partitions */
165 +       namelen = 8;
166 +       if (rootfslen > 0){
167 +               nrparts++;
168 +               namelen =+ 6;
169 +       };
170 +       if (kernellen > 0) {
171 +               nrparts++;
172 +               namelen =+ 6;
173 +       };
174 +
175 +       /* Ask kernel for more memory */
176 +       parts = kzalloc(sizeof(*parts) * nrparts + 10 * nrparts, GFP_KERNEL);
177 +       if (!parts) {
178 +               vfree(buf);
179 +               return -ENOMEM;
180 +       };
181 +
182 +       /* Start building partition list */
183 +       parts[curpart].name = "CFE";
184 +       parts[curpart].offset = 0;
185 +       parts[curpart].size = master->erasesize;
186 +       curpart++;
187 +
188 +       if (kernellen > 0) {
189 +               parts[curpart].name = "kernel";
190 +               parts[curpart].offset = kerneladdr;
191 +               parts[curpart].size = kernellen;
192 +               curpart++;
193 +       };
194 +
195 +       if (rootfslen > 0) {
196 +               parts[curpart].name = "rootfs";
197 +               parts[curpart].offset = rootfsaddr;
198 +               parts[curpart].size = rootfslen;
199 +               if (sparelen > 0)
200 +                       parts[curpart].size += sparelen;
201 +               curpart++;
202 +       };
203 +
204 +       parts[curpart].name = "nvram";
205 +       parts[curpart].offset = master->size - master->erasesize;
206 +       parts[curpart].size = master->erasesize;
207 +
208 +       /* Global partition "linux" to make easy firmware upgrade */
209 +       curpart++;
210 +       parts[curpart].name = "linux";
211 +       parts[curpart].offset = parts[0].size;
212 +       parts[curpart].size = master->size - parts[0].size - parts[3].size;
213 +
214 +       for (i = 0; i < nrparts; i++)
215 +               printk(KERN_INFO PFX "Partition %d is %s offset %lx and length %lx\n", i, parts[i].name, (long unsigned int)(parts[i].offset), (long unsigned int)(parts[i].size));
216 +
217 +       printk(KERN_INFO PFX "Spare partition is %x offset and length %x\n", spareaddr, sparelen);
218 +       *pparts = parts;
219 +       vfree(buf);
220 +
221 +       return nrparts;
222 +};
